Dirt Wetness Sensors



Dirt dampness sensing units play an essential duty in modern-day irrigation systems, giving real-time data that enhances water efficiency. These tools gauge the volumetric water content in the soil, enabling specific evaluations of wetness degrees. By integrating soil dampness sensing units right into irrigation systems, customers can avoid overwatering or underwatering, eventually advertising much healthier plant growth and saving water resources.The sensing units transmit data to controllers, which can change sprinkling timetables based upon existing dirt problems. This data-driven approach reduces water waste and assurances that plants get the ideal amount of wetness. Additionally, soil wetness sensors can be advantageous in numerous farming setups, from home yards to massive farms. The deployment of these sensors adds to sustainable techniques by sustaining liable water use and lowering environmental impact. Generally, the unification of soil moisture sensing units marks a considerable development in accomplishing reliable watering systems.

What Is the Lifespan of Modern Lawn Sprinkler Elements?





The life-span of modern-day lawn sprinkler elements typically varies from 5 to 20 years, depending on the products utilized, upkeep techniques, and ecological problems. Routine maintenance can substantially boost durability and efficiency over time.
